Software Developer Engineer, Platform - AWS Load Balancing

Amazon Web Services (AWS) is the world's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uously innovating.
Backend
Mid-Level Software Engineer
Contact Company
5,000+ Employees
Enterprise SaaS · Cloud
This job posting may no longer be active. You may be interested in these related jobs instead:
Industrial Design Engineer, R2L Design

Industrial Design Engineer position at Amazon's R2L team, focusing on logistics infrastructure and delivery system optimization.

Software Development Engineer, Pricing Customer Experience

Build and enhance pricing experiences at Amazon, improving customer trust and price perception for millions of users globally.

Cluster Project Design Electrical Engineer, Fleet Remediation Engineering

Lead data center infrastructure design and upgrades as a Fleet Remediation Project Design Electrical Engineer at AWS, ensuring optimal performance of cloud computing facilities.

Quality Assurance Engineer, Ring Alarm

Quality Assurance Engineer position at Ring focusing on testing and qualifying smart home security products and applications.

Software Development Engineer, PXF Learn

Full-stack Software Development Engineer role at Amazon Learn, building cloud-based learning solutions for employee development using AWS technologies.

Description For Software Developer Engineer, Platform - AWS Load Balancing

Developers all over the world rely on AWS Load Balancing services to ensure their applications and services are highly available. The success of AWS depends on our world-class network and server infrastructure; we're handling massive scale and rapid integration of emerging technologies. We're looking for an experienced Software Engineer to join the Internal Load Balancing team in support of the onboarding of customers to AWS Load Balancing.

As a Software Engineer, you will:

  • Play an integral role in building, maintaining, and monitoring tools and services created to support our customers in managing their network capabilities effectively.
  • Ensure availability of customer services by following best practices.
  • Build software that accelerates on-boarding of customers to AWS services.
  • Create analytics to expose migration health insights.
  • Work on Amazon's hardest problems, building high quality, architecturally sound systems aligned with business needs.
  • Strive for simplicity, demonstrate creativity and high judgment, and contribute towards intellectual property through patents.

You'll be part of the AWS Utility Computing (UC) organization, which provides product innovations from foundational services like Amazon S3 and EC2 to new product innovations that set AWS apart in the industry. Within AWS UC, you'll engage with AWS customers who require specialized security solutions for their cloud services.

Key responsibilities:

  • Solve problems at scale
  • Design solutions by talking directly to customers
  • Automate and innovate
  • Focus on writing code right the first time
  • Deliver fast iterative solutions focused on real customer value
  • Launch, own, support, and incrementally improve your code
  • Decompose complex problems into simple solutions
  • Develop and mentor others
  • Work in a flexible, fast-paced, collaborative team environment

AWS values diverse experiences and encourages applications even if you don't meet all qualifications. The team fosters an inclusive culture through employee-led affinity groups and ongoing events and learning experiences.

This role offers opportunities for mentorship, career growth, work-life harmony, and the chance to be part of a team that's shaping the future of cloud computing.

Last updated 3 months ago

Responsibilities For Software Developer Engineer, Platform - AWS Load Balancing

  • Build, maintain, and monitor tools and services for AWS Load Balancing
  • Support customer onboarding to AWS Load Balancing services
  • Design solutions by talking directly to customers
  • Build high quality, architecturally sound systems aligned with business needs
  • Create analytics to expose migration health insights
  • Contribute towards intellectual property through patents
  • Mentor and develop team members

Requirements For Software Developer Engineer, Platform - AWS Load Balancing

Java
Python
  • Experience (non-internship) in professional software development
  • Experience designing or architecting (design patterns, reliability and scaling) of new and existing systems
  • Experience programming with at least one software programming language
  • Bachelor's degree in computer science or equivalent (preferred)

Benefits For Software Developer Engineer, Platform - AWS Load Balancing

  • Flexible work hours
  • Career advancement resources
  • Employee-led affinity groups
  • Ongoing learning experiences

Interested in this job?